Lubing Hinges
If window operation is stiff or noisy, it might just need lubrication. To lubricate hinges:

Materials Needed:
Silicone spray or lube Clean fabricScrewdriver
Treatment:
Open the window totally.Utilize a tidy fabric to wipe dirt and particles from the hinges.Apply the lubricant straight to the hinge mechanism.Open and close the [Emergency Window Hinge Repairs](https://www.ardacademy.org/members/snakeangora66/activity/44845/) several times to disperse the lube uniformly.2. Tightening Loose Hinges
Loose hinges can impact window operation and security.

Materials Needed:
ScrewdriverWood filler (if necessary)
Procedure:

Q2: What type of lube is best for window hinges?
A: Silicone-based lubes are suggested as they do not attract dust and provide lasting protection against rust.

Q4: How frequently should I inspect my window hinges?
A: It's advisable to check window hinges biannually, especially before and after severe weather seasons.
